Holiday Lighting Safety Tips

The holiday season is a magical time, and outdoor holiday lights can transform your home into a festive wonderland. However, it's crucial to prioritize safety when installing and maintaining your holiday lights. Choose the Right Lights

Selecting the appropriate lights for outdoor use is the first step to a safe holiday display.

  • Outdoor-Rated Lights: Always use lights that are labeled for outdoor use. These lights are designed to withstand the elements and are safer for exterior installations.
  • LED Lights: Consider using LED lights, which are more energy-efficient, generate less heat, and are less likely to cause fires.

Inspect Lights and Cords

Before hanging your lights, carefully inspect them to ensure they are in good condition.

  • Check for Damage: Look for frayed wires, broken sockets, or damaged insulation. Discard any lights that show signs of wear and tear.
  • Replace Bulbs: Replace any burnt-out bulbs with ones of the same wattage to prevent overloading the circuit.

Use Extension Cords Safely

Proper use of extension cords is essential for a safe holiday lighting display.

  • Outdoor-Rated Extension Cords: Use extension cords that are rated for outdoor use and can handle the wattage of your lights.
  • Avoid Overloading: Do not overload extension cords. Check the maximum wattage rating and ensure your lights do not exceed it.
  • Secure Connections: Keep all connections off the ground and away from water. Use waterproof extension cord covers to protect connections from moisture.

Utilize Timers and Smart Plugs

Timers and smart plugs can enhance the safety and convenience of your holiday lighting.

  • Timers: Set timers to turn your lights on and off automatically. This saves energy and reduces the risk of overheating.
  • Smart Plugs: Use smart plugs to control your lights remotely and set schedules. This can also provide additional safety by allowing you to turn off lights if you forget.

Weatherproof Your Setup

Protect your lights and connections from the elements to ensure they remain safe throughout the season.

  • Weatherproof Boxes: Use weatherproof electrical boxes for outlets and plugs to keep them dry and protected.
  • Waterproof Tape: Secure connections with waterproof electrical tape to prevent moisture from causing shorts or shocks.
  • Elevate Connections: Keep electrical connections off the ground, especially in areas prone to water accumulation.

Secure Your Lights Properly

Properly securing your lights prevents damage and reduces the risk of accidents.

  • Use Clips and Hooks: Avoid using nails, staples, or tacks to hang lights, as they can damage the wiring. Instead, use plastic clips or hooks designed for hanging holiday lights.
  • Avoid Overstretching: Do not stretch light strings tightly. Leave some slack to prevent tension on the wires.
  • Stable Ladders: When hanging lights, use a stable ladder and follow proper ladder safety guidelines. Always work with a partner if possible.

Practice General Safety

In addition to specific lighting tips, general safety practices are important to keep in mind.

  • Turn Off When Unattended: Always turn off holiday lights when you go to bed or leave the house to reduce the risk of fire.
  • Keep Away from Flammable Materials: Ensure lights are not in contact with flammable materials such as dry leaves, paper, or curtains.
  • Monitor Weather Conditions: Be mindful of weather conditions, especially high winds or heavy rain, which can damage your lights and create hazards.

Regular Maintenance

Maintaining your holiday lights throughout the season ensures they stay safe and functional.

  • Regular Checks: Periodically check your lights and connections for any signs of damage or wear. Replace any damaged components immediately.
  • Keep Clean: Clear away any debris, such as leaves or snow, that might accumulate around your lights and connections.
